Transaction cac16b64db6865ad33bbbe120c7d6891dade4d015cf5fcca791243fc8d9e6ba8

1 Input
2 Outputs
  • cac16b64db6865ad33bbbe120c7d6891dade4d015cf5fcca791243fc8d9e6ba8:0
  • value  549339
    address  17a99rhZ2ouNLYmP6x88F2JE31uCqpMrS3
  • cac16b64db6865ad33bbbe120c7d6891dade4d015cf5fcca791243fc8d9e6ba8:1
  • value  12437987
    address  1JAD7msg3CtpangbyfTh4DZa6Rw9KKjYRC